Characterization of biogenic content of municipal waste: ENVEA takes part in UIOM ¹⁴C program - Case Study
The program “UIOM 14C” has featured a measurement campaign of the fossil and biogenic CO2 emitted by french incinerators. The study, implemented under the sponsorship of ADEME, FNADE and local partner communities, took place in 2018 and 2019, across 11 sites. It represented a population of 10 million inhabitants and 10% of the waste incinerated in France. In practice, measurements ...

Biogen food waste anaerobic digestion plant, St Asaph - Case Study
Biogen provides an integrated food waste management solution for supermarkets, caterers, pubs, hotels, food manufacturers and local authorities across the UK. Biogen’s plant at Waen, St Asaph in Wales processes waste from a variety of county’s such as Conwy, Swansea, Denbighshire and Flintshire. The anaerobic digestion (AD) plant processes 22,500 tonnes of food waste per year which ...

Project Waste 2 Go - Upgrading Municipal Waste - Case Study
Waste2Go is a research and technological development (RTD) project, co-funded under the European Union's Seventh Framework Programme (FP7), the "Environment" Theme. The objective is to transform the biogenic fraction of Municipal Solid Waste (over 55%) into chemicals with an economic value greater than if it was used as an energy source. The project hopes to reduce pressure on primary raw ...
